Dry storage cabinets (Trockenlagerschränke) maintain a controlled low-humidity environment - typically <5% RH at room temperature - to protect moisture-sensitive components (MSDs) classified under IPC/JEDEC J-STD-033 levels MSL 2 through MSL 6. Unlike nitrogen cabinets, desiccant-based dry cabinets reach target humidity within minutes without gas consumption, delivering stable conditions at <1% RH for the most critical SMT components, BGA packages, and bare PCBs. Storage in a certified dry cabinet directly replaces baking cycles, reducing thermal stress on components and cutting rework costs.

Dry Storage Cabinets - Product Overview
| Type | Humidity Range | Typical Capacity | Key Application | Norm / Standard |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Benchtop dry cabinet | <5% RH | ca. 30-60 L | SMD reels, BGA packages at workstation | IPC/JEDEC J-STD-033C |
| Floor-standing dry cabinet | <1% RH | ca. 200-600 L | Bulk MSD storage, MSL 5-6 components | IPC/JEDEC J-STD-033C, IEC 61340-5-1 |
| ESD dry cabinet with logging | <5% RH, ±2% RH | ca. 60-200 L | Traceable MSD storage in EPA, audit-ready | ISO 13485, IATF 16949, IEC 61340-5-1 |
| Nitrogen dry cabinet | <1% RH | ca. 100-400 L | Semiconductor wafers, bare dies, MEMS | SEMI S1/S2, IPC/JEDEC J-STD-033C |
